Transitioning an outdoor cat to become an indoor cat can be done gradually by providing a stimulating indoor environment with toys, scratching posts, and climbing structures. Start by keeping the cat indoors for short periods and gradually increase the time. Provide a litter box and ensure the cat has access to windows for stimulation. Be patient and consistent in the transition process.
